This substantial capital injection is primarily directed towards <strong>semiconductors, biopharmaceuticals, artificial intelligence (AI)<\/strong>, and <em>next-generation communication technologies<\/em>, underscoring the conglomerate&#39;s commitment to securing long-term growth and robust domestic supply chains.<\/p>\n<p>A significant portion of this investment, <strong>360 trillion won (80%)<\/strong>, is earmarked for <strong>research and development<\/strong> and talent nurturing within South Korea, particularly in advanced chipmaking. This aggressive spending plan represents a <strong>30% increase<\/strong> compared to the <strong>330 trillion won<\/strong> invested by Samsung over the preceding five-year period. The initiative is projected to stimulate the creation of <strong>1.07 million jobs<\/strong>, further boosting the South Korean economy.<\/p>\n<p>In a related development, <strong>Samsung Electronics (<a href=\"\/stock\/005930.KS\">005930.KS<\/a>)<\/strong> confirmed plans to add an <strong>additional chip production line<\/strong> at its sprawling Pyeongtaek plant in South Korea. This expansion is a direct response to the burgeoning global demand fueled by the AI boom, with mass production from the new line slated to commence in <strong>2028<\/strong>. The company also intends to make further infrastructure investments to support its expanded operations. This move follows ongoing efforts at the Pyeongtaek campus, a vital hub for Samsung&#39;s foundry business, which has seen adjustments and resumptions of construction on various plants (P3, P4, P5) to capitalize on the surging demand for AI chips and high-bandwidth memory.<\/p>\n<p>Meanwhile, Japan is preparing a significant fiscal intervention, with its government considering an <strong>economic stimulus package<\/strong> that will exceed <strong>17 trillion yen<\/strong> (approximately <strong>$110 billion USD<\/strong>), as reported by the Nikkei newspaper. The package is designed to counteract the economic pressures of <em>rising living costs<\/em> and to strategically boost investment in key growth areas, including <strong>artificial intelligence<\/strong> and <strong>semiconductors<\/strong>.<\/p>\n<p>Finance Minister Katayama has been instrumental in these discussions, with the package expected to be finalized and approved by the cabinet on <strong>November 21<\/strong>. The proposed measures include broader <strong>exemptions on income tax, cuts on gasoline taxes, subsidies for utility bills<\/strong>, and allocated funds for prefectures to support food aid initiatives. Finance Minister Satsuki Katayama has also recently reiterated warnings against <em>excessive yen weakness<\/em>, highlighting the government&#39;s watchful stance on currency stability amidst these economic maneuvers. The supplementary budget to fund this package is anticipated to be around <strong>14 trillion yen<\/strong>.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Key Takeaways Samsung Group has
